Background
The access control management is a digital access control system which can control the access of personnel, can also control the behavior of the personnel in a building and a sensitive area, and accurately records and counts management data, the access control management is widely applied, the existing intelligent access control management device basically has the function of face recognition, dust can be adhered to a glass panel of the existing intelligent access control management panel in the using process, the recognition effect of a face recognition camera can be influenced, Chinese patent with the publication number of CN 215182200U is authorized through retrieval, the intelligent access control management device based on the face recognition technology is disclosed, the intelligent access control management device has the function of conveniently removing the dust on the face recognition camera at any time, thereby the situation that the face recognition camera is blocked by the dust and is difficult to recognize is prevented, but cleaning pieces such as doctor blades, air pipes and the like are externally arranged, can influence the aesthetic property, simultaneously at the in-process that uses, because it adopts external mode, receive external factor's influence more easily, consequently, the utility model provides a wisdom entrance guard management device based on face identification technique is used for solving above-mentioned problem.

Referring to fig. 1-5, an intelligent entrance guard management device based on face recognition technology comprises an outer shell 1 and an inner shell 2, wherein one side of the inner shell 2 is fixedly provided with an electric push rod 21, one end of the electric push rod 21 far away from the inner shell 2 is fixedly arranged on the outer shell 1, the inner shell 2 can be controlled to perform transverse position adjustment through the electric push rod 21, a face recognition camera and a card reading module are arranged in the inner shell 2, one side of the inner shell 2 far away from the electric push rod 21 is fixedly provided with a glass panel 25, one side of the outer shell 1 is provided with a rectangular opening, the rectangular opening is matched with the inner shell 2, a servo motor 34 is fixedly arranged on the inner wall of the top of the outer shell 1, an output shaft of the servo motor 34 is fixedly sleeved with a driving pulley 35, the inner walls of the front side and the rear side of the outer shell 1 are rotatably provided with the same reciprocating lead screw 3, and a moving block 31 is arranged on the reciprocating lead screw 3 in a threaded manner, the bottom side of the moving block 31 is fixedly provided with a strip-shaped hollow plate 4, one side of the strip-shaped hollow plate 4 close to the glass panel 25 is provided with a plurality of nozzles 41 at equal intervals, cleaning liquid can be sprayed on the glass panel 25 through the plurality of nozzles 41, the reciprocating lead screw 3 is fixedly sleeved with a driven pulley 33, the driving pulley 35 and the driven pulley 33 are in transmission connection with the same belt 36, the reciprocating lead screw 3 can be driven to rotate under the action of a servo motor 34, the driving pulley 35 and the belt 36, the front and rear inner walls of the outer shell 1 are fixedly provided with the same L-shaped partition plate 5, the small water pump 52 and the liquid storage tank 51 can be isolated into an independent space, the inner wall at the bottom of the outer shell 1 is fixedly provided with the liquid storage tank 51 and the small water pump 52, the same telescopic hose 43 is connected between the water inlet of the small water pump 52 and the strip-shaped hollow plate 4, and the water inlet of the small water pump 52 is communicated with the liquid storage tank 51, one side that glass panels 25 was kept away from to interior casing 2 is provided with cooling fan 26, has seted up the air outlet on the shell body 1, and the bottom fixed mounting of shell body 1 has a plurality of drain pipes, is convenient for with the sewage discharge shell body 1 that the cleaning process produced.
In this embodiment, one side fixed mounting of interior casing 2 has ejector pin 22, and fixed mounting has press switch 11 on the one side inner wall of shell body 1, and ejector pin 22 and press switch 11 are located same horizontal axis, and press switch 11 and little water pump 52 and servo motor 34 electric connection, can drive ejector pin 22 when interior casing 2 left motion and press the operation to press switch 11 to can start little water pump 52 and servo motor 34 work.
In this embodiment, a scraper 42 is fixedly installed on one side of the strip-shaped hollow plate 4 close to the glass panel 25, the scraper 42 is in contact with the glass panel 25, and the dirt on the glass panel 25 can be cleaned when the strip-shaped hollow plate 4 moves along with the moving block 31 through the scraper 42.
In this embodiment, horizontal fixed mounting has a plurality of telescopic links 23 on one side inner wall of shell body 1, and the other end of a plurality of telescopic links 23 all with interior casing 2 fixed connection, can make interior casing 2 remain stable motion through a plurality of telescopic links 23.
In this embodiment, a plurality of guide rods 32 are horizontally and fixedly mounted on the inner walls of the front and rear sides of the outer housing 1, the moving block 31 is slidably connected to the plurality of guide rods 32, and the moving block 31 can be stably moved by the plurality of guide rods 32.
In this embodiment, all rotate on the inner wall of both sides around the air outlet and install the rotating pin, be located two on the same horizontal axis and rotate round pin fixed mounting and have same rotation shrouding, two adjacent rotation shroudings contact, and one side fixed mounting that shell body 1 is close to the air outlet has the otter board, and otter board and air outlet looks adaptation, can guarantee normal ventilation at radiator fan 26 during operation through rotating the shrouding, can seal the air outlet when radiator fan 26 stop work simultaneously, thereby can avoid entering such as debris.
In this embodiment, the top of the inner housing 2 is fixedly provided with a limiting strip 24, and the position of the inner housing 2 can be limited by the limiting strip 24.
The working principle is as follows: when the glass panel cleaning machine is used, firstly, the power is switched on, the inner shell 2 is pulled to move leftwards through the electric push rod 21 to the position shown in figure 2, the push rod 22 is driven to extrude the press switch 11 when the inner shell 2 moves leftwards, so that the small water pump 52 and the servo motor 34 can be controlled to work, the servo motor 34 drives the reciprocating lead screw 3 to rotate through the driving belt wheel 35, the belt 36 and the driven belt wheel 33, so that the moving block 31 can drive the strip-shaped hollow plate 4 to keep reciprocating motion along the reciprocating lead screw 3, dirt on the glass panel 25 can be scraped under the action of the scraper 42, the small water pump 52 conveys cleaning liquid in the liquid storage tank 51 to the strip-shaped hollow plate 4 through the telescopic hose 43, then the glass panel 25 is sprayed under the action of the plurality of nozzles 41, meanwhile, the cleaning of the glass panel 25 is realized under the cooperation of the scraper 42, and sewage generated by the cleaning is discharged downwards under the action of the plurality of the drain pipes, remove strip hollow plate 4 from the motion path of interior casing 2 after the clearance is accomplished, then promote interior casing 2 through electric putter 21 and move in to the rectangle mouth, can make the right flank of interior casing 2 and the right flank of shell body 1 keep in same vertical plane under spacing 24 effect.
